Kotze-Ramos to lead Downey chamber

DOWNEY - Patricia Kotze-Ramos, owner of a private investigation firm in Downey, will be installed as president of the Downey Chamber of Commerce on June 27.Kotze-Ramos, a candidate for state Assembly, has belonged to the chamber for six years and is current chairman of its Business Watch group. Meanwhile, Alex Saab will be installed as president-elect. Other installations include Elizabeth Trombley, vice president; George Zoumberakis, treasurer; and Jan Scott, immediate past president. New additions to the board of directors include Steve Lopez, John Quagliani and Jeannie Wood.
